I have 3 set of reports in my app workspace of premium . Out of 3 all the 3 reports should be visbile to Internal team in my org and only 2 reports should be visbible to B2B users . Currently i am using publish app feature for sharing the reports . Real issue here is i can create only one Publish app for one worksapce .So i have internal group in one SG and external users in another SG . But even the external B2B users are able to see 3 reports in the naviagtion . If i hide the report from the navigation pane even the internal users are not able to see it . Is there any way to crack this using pubish app feature please?

I don't believe this functionality is available. You can reduce the rows of data that people see in a report dynamically but not the visuals on the page or the report pages that they see.
Although not ideal, I would probably create two workspaces and publish the apps seperately to the two groups.
